Discover the Best IPTV App for Android to Stream Live TV

Curious which player will make live TV crisp, fast, and reliable on your device?

This buyer’s guide helps Canadian viewers choose an app iptv for android that matches their device and viewing habits. It explains that a player only runs the channels provided by your subscription, and the service supplies the actual content.

We compare real-world options based on speed, stability, EPG quality, playlist support, and interface. The focus is on present, usable choices and practical setup steps rather than theory.

Expect to learn how performance varies across phones, TV boxes, NVIDIA Shield, and Android TV. We also flag how free versus paid versions change the experience through ads, updates, and premium features.

The article will walk you through definitions, must-have features, a quick comparison, deep reviews, setup steps, and a compatibility checklist. By the end, you’ll know which player is the best iptv fit for your budget and device.

Key Takeaways

  • This guide helps Canadians pick the right player for their device and habits.
  • A player runs channels from your subscription; it does not supply them.
  • We test apps on speed, stability, EPG, playlist support, and UI.
  • Device type and paid vs free versions greatly affect performance.
  • Read on for setup steps, reviews, and a compatibility checklist.

    best iptv app for android

What an IPTV App Is and Why It Matters for Streaming in Canada

Not all streaming software behaves the same; the right one matters for live TV in Canada.

Plain definition: An iptv app is the player that reads your provider’s playlist and credentials. It does not supply channels. The channels, EPG, and VOD come from the iptv service you subscribe to.

That split matters because Canadians often choose a player separately from their subscription. A better player reduces buffering, speeds channel switching, and gives cleaner navigation through large lineups. Small UX gains make live sports and news easier to follow.

Compare that to OTT streaming: platforms like Netflix are self-contained catalogs over the public internet. By contrast, an iptv app ingests playlists (M3U, Xtream Codes) and relies on provider-controlled delivery to stream content.

Some problems come from services — server congestion or regional limits. Others are player-side, such as poor EPG handling or heavy ads. In Canada, device choice (TV boxes, phones, set-top players) and the need for stable live TV should guide your pick.

Up next: the features that most affect day-to-day streaming quality, including EPG, catch-up, and playlist support.

Must-Have Features to Look for in an app iptv for android

Prioritize stability and navigation so live channels feel effortless on any screen.

EPG support for a better live channels experience

Good EPG removes guesswork. It shows schedules, makes channel browsing fast, and cuts the number of missed shows.

Look for XMLTV/JTV compatibility and clear program grids. This feature is non-negotiable when you watch many channels.

Catch-up, recording, and time-shifting

Catch-up works only if your subscription archives content. Time-shift and recording depend on storage and permissions.

On Android box setups, some players handle recordings better than others. Check file locations and autoplay behavior.

Multi-screen and Picture-in-Picture

Multi-screen and PiP are power-user tools for sports nights or busy homes. They let you watch multiple feeds without switching apps.

Playlist formats and practical playlist support

M3U covers basic needs. XSPF helps with advanced playlists, and Xtream Codes often simplifies logins and management.

Interface and TV-friendly design

Choose a remote-first user interface with readable layouts on large screens. Lightweight players load faster on low-end devices, while rich features need stronger hardware.

  • EPG and schedule clarity
  • Catch-up and recording options
  • Multi-screen/PiP and performance
  • Playlist support: M3U, XSPF, Xtream Codes
  • Remote-friendly interface on android box and other devices

Top IPTV Apps for Android in the Present: Quick Comparison of the Best Options

This quick comparison helps you shortlist 2–3 players based on how you watch live TV at home.

TiviMate — Best for Android TV users who need a smooth, remote-friendly interface and fast navigation through large channel lists.

IPTV Smarters Pro — The easy-start choice with simple login flows and clear sections for Live, VOD, and series. Good for beginners.

XCIPTV — A balanced option that pairs a built-in player with enough customization to please power users without overwhelming newcomers.

  • OTT Navigator — Ideal when you manage multiple subscriptions and want deep sorting and filtering controls.
  • Perfect Player — Lightweight and stability-first, with strong EPG readability on big screens like an android box setup.
  • GSE Smart IPTV — Best when cross-device compatibility matters; it plays well across varied devices beyond phones.

Use this list to narrow choices by priority: speed and EPG, simple setup, or cross-device compatibility. In the next sections we’ll deep-dive into the most-searched picks and who each one fits best.

Spotlight Review: TiviMate IPTV Player for Android TV Users

If you use a TV box or NVIDIA Shield every day, TiviMate often feels like the most polished way to watch live channels.

Who benefits: TiviMate is ideal for Canadian Android TV and Shield users who want a cable-like live TV experience. It suits viewers who browse many channels and value speed and layout consistency across large screens.

A sleek, modern interface of the TiviMate IPTV player displayed on a high-definition Android TV screen, taking center stage in a contemporary living room setting. In the foreground, the TV remote rests on a stylish coffee table, hinting at user engagement, while digital icons representing various live TV channels float around the screen, showcasing the app's vast offerings. The middle ground features a cozy couch with vibrant cushions, creating an inviting atmosphere, and soft lighting casts a warm glow throughout the space. In the background, a stylish bookshelf adds depth and context to the room, enhancing the ambiance. The overall mood is relaxed and tech-savvy, evoking the ease and enjoyment of streaming live TV through TiviMate.

Key strengths: The player delivers very fast channel switching and strong playlist organization. Advanced EPG controls help heavy channel surfers find shows quickly. Multiple playlists can be grouped into favorites to cut scrolling time.

Limitations and licensing: The interface is focused on Android TV devices, so phone-first users may miss a uniform experience across smaller screens. Many useful features sit behind a premium license. If live TV is your primary use and you watch daily, the paid upgrade often pays back in saved time and smoother navigation.

  • Best on TV boxes and NVIDIA Shield
  • Organize multi-playlist setups into groups and favorites
  • Premium unlocks recording, more favorites, and multi-user support

Practical note: Overall stability still depends on your subscription quality, but a strong player can make channel surfing feel dramatically better. For a simpler, quick-setup alternative, consider IPTV Smarters Pro next.

Spotlight Review: IPTV Smarters Pro for Easy Streaming and Navigation

iptv smarters pro is a solid first pick for Canadians who want a fast, tidy way to start streaming.

smarters pro organizes content into clear sections: Live TV, VOD, and Series. That layout reduces confusion and speeds up channel discovery for new users.

Key features

  • EPG and playlist support — M3U and Xtream Codes options help with program guides and quick imports.
  • Parental controls — Useful on shared TV setups to block channels or limit viewing times.
  • External player support — Swap to a different player when a stream format needs special handling.

Why Xtream Codes helps beginners

Xtream Codes uses a server URL plus username and password. That often means fewer manual edits than raw M3U files and automatic EPG mapping, so setup feels easier.

Features can vary by device and version, and multi-screen support may appear on some setups. This app suits users who prefer simple navigation and familiar layouts. Power users who want deeper control will likely move to XCIPTV or OTT Navigator next.

Spotlight Review: XCIPTV Player, OTT Navigator, and Perfect Player IPTV

Pick the style that fits your viewing: customization, power tools, or rock‑solid playback.

XCIPTV

Built-in player and customization: XCIPTV combines an integrated player with skin and layout tweaks so your setup feels personal without long setup time.

Catch-up support: The player will surface catch-up only when your provider includes it, so verify subscription support before you expect recordings.

OTT Navigator

Advanced IPTV tools: This is the power-user pick. It offers deep filtering, sorting, and granular EPG controls that tame very large playlists.

“When guide data powers your planning, OTT Navigator keeps schedules clear and manageable.”

Perfect Player

Stability-first option: Perfect Player delivers a clean, readable interface and reliable playback on bigger screens. Its minimal menus put EPG clarity front and center.

Quick decision guide:

  • Choose XCIPTV for a ready-made player with useful features and light customization.
  • Pick OTT Navigator if you manage massive lists and need advanced sorting and EPG control.
  • Go with Perfect Player when simplicity, speed, and a clean interface matter most.

How to Set Up Your IPTV App on Android Using M3U or Xtream Codes

A clean setup makes channels load faster and keeps guide data accurate across devices.

M3U playlist setup basics and EPG notes

Most players accept an M3U URL or a local M3U file. In the app, choose “Add playlist” and paste the M3U link, or select “Load file” to import a saved list.

If programs show as unnamed entries, you may need to add an EPG URL (XMLTV). An EPG URL tells the player where to fetch schedule data so the guide displays correctly.

Xtream Codes setup: server URL, username, password

Choose the Xtream Codes or XTREAM login option in your player. Enter three fields: server URL, username, and password. Save and let the player sync.

Why it helps: Xtream Codes often pulls channels, VOD, and guide data automatically, so initial setup is faster and cleaner for many users.

Manage multiple playlists without slowing down your player

  1. Prune unused groups and delete old lists.
  2. Disable auto-refresh if it’s optional; update manually at a convenient time.
  3. Keep only the channels you watch to reduce load and speed up navigation.

Testers of free iptv playlists should expect broken links, frequent changes, and missing guide data. These lists are useful for short trials but not reliable long term.

Final tip: Large playlists can slow performance more than device limits do. Optimize your lists and then check the compatibility checklist to pick the right iptv app for your Canadian hardware.

Compatibility Checklist: Choosing the Right IPTV App for Your Android Device

Start by naming the main device you’ll watch on; that choice shapes the rest.

Quick checklist to run through:

  • Which device is primary? Phone, tablet, TV box, Shield, or Chromebook?
  • Does the player have a remote‑friendly UI or a touch layout?
  • Is the app listed in the app store or only sideloaded?
  • Are updates recent and frequent?
  • Do reviews mention heavy ads or privacy concerns?

Android TV, NVIDIA Shield, and android box considerations

On TV-grade hardware prioritize a remote-first interface and fast EPG navigation.

TiviMate, XCIPTV, and OTT Navigator often match these device needs. Cheap android box models may need lightweight players or trimmed playlists to keep the viewing experience smooth.

Phone, tablet, and Chromebook expectations

Touch UI, casting support, and battery impact matter on portable devices. Phones and tablets want responsive controls and lower ad loads during long sessions.

Google Play availability vs sideloading

Apps on google play update automatically and show privacy disclosures. Sideloading gives flexibility but adds maintenance and update overhead.

Performance and trust signals

Check update recency, review volume (real comments over star counts), and ad complaints. Look at app store privacy notes: what data is collected and whether traffic is encrypted in transit.

Conclusion

Choosing software that fits your hardware and playlist size often improves stability more than upgrades do.

Bottom line: the right iptv app is the one that matches your device, playlist size, and feature needs—not just the most popular name. Remember the core split: an iptv service supplies channels, and the player organizes and plays them. That distinction avoids wasted purchases and setup time.

Quick wrap-up: TiviMate suits Android TV and Shield users who want polish. IPTV Smarters Pro is best for beginners. OTT Navigator fits power users. Perfect Player favors stability, and GSE Smart IPTV works well across devices. Prioritize EPG quality, playlist support, and a TV-friendly UI. Use trusted sources, keep software updated, and test one choice with Xtream Codes or an M3U link for a week to confirm it’s the right iptv fit for your home.

FAQ

What exactly is an IPTV player and why does it matter for streaming in Canada?

An IPTV player is software that receives live TV and on-demand streams over the internet, replacing traditional cable tuners. It matters because the right player improves channel stability, reduces buffering, and offers features like electronic program guides (EPG) and recording that make viewing smoother on devices such as Android TV boxes, NVIDIA Shield, phones, and tablets.

How is an IPTV player different from an IPTV service?

The player is the interface and playback engine you install; the service supplies channel streams, playlists (M3U), and credentials like Xtream Codes. You need both: a reliable service for content and a capable player for navigation, speed, and compatibility across devices.

What benefits does a dedicated player bring compared with OTT apps like Netflix or Hulu?

Dedicated players focus on linear live channels and offer fast channel switching, EPG integration, catch-up and time-shift tools, and playlist support. OTT apps center on on-demand catalogs and apps’ ecosystems. For live sports and many international channels, a specialized player delivers the practical features viewers want today.

Which features should I prioritize when choosing a player?

Look for solid EPG support, catch-up and recording functions, multi-screen or Picture-in-Picture, broad playlist compatibility (M3U and Xtream Codes), and a TV-friendly interface that works well with remotes on Android TV and boxes.

What is EPG and why is it important?

EPG stands for Electronic Program Guide. It shows schedules and program details for live channels, making it easy to browse, set recordings, or jump to upcoming shows. Strong EPG support transforms a long list of channels into usable TV-like navigation.

Can I record or time-shift live content with most players?

Many modern players support local recording and time-shifting, but availability depends on the player and your device storage. Some features may require a premium license or a provider that supplies catch-up windows.

What playlist formats do players usually accept?

Common formats include M3U, XSPF, and login methods like Xtream Codes. Choose a player that supports multiple playlist types so you can mix subscriptions without juggling incompatible files.

Which options work best on Android TV boxes and NVIDIA Shield?

Players with lean, remote-friendly interfaces and strong EPG handling work best. TiviMate is known for Android TV focus, while Perfect Player offers a lightweight, stable layout. Ensure the player supports hardware decoding for smoother playback on boxes.

What are some top choices for people who want easy setup?

IPTV Smarters Pro is popular among beginners for simple login flows, clear menus, and integrated support for Live TV, VOD, and external players. It also accepts Xtream Codes style credentials for quick connections.

Which players suit power users who manage many channels and subscriptions?

OTT Navigator handles large playlists with advanced filtering and EPG controls. XCIPTV balances built-in player features with customization, and Perfect Player focuses on stability for heavy use. These are good if you juggle multiple services.

Is there a lightweight player with strong EPG support?

Yes—Perfect Player emphasizes performance and a clean, readable layout, making it ideal on less powerful boxes or when you want low system load without losing reliable program guides.

How do I set up an M3U playlist and get EPG working?

Add the M3U link or file in the player’s playlist section. If EPG doesn’t map automatically, you can load an EPG XMLTV URL or manually link guide files in settings. Some players need manual mapping of channels to guide entries.

What does Xtream Codes setup require?

Xtream Codes-style logins typically need a server URL, username, and password. Enter those in the player’s login screen; the app then pulls channel lists, EPG, and VOD offered by the provider for a seamless experience.

Any tips for managing multiple playlists without slowing the player?

Keep playlists organized by source, disable unused lists, and avoid importing extremely large duplicate guides. Use players that support external storage for cache and prefer hardware decoding on compatible devices to reduce CPU load.

How do I know if a player is safe and regularly updated?

Check Google Play availability for official releases, read recent user reviews, and look at update history and changelogs. Apps that update often and have responsive support teams are more trustworthy and stable over time.

What should I expect when sideloading versus installing from Google Play?

Sideloading can provide access to more features but may risk missing automatic updates and security checks. Installing from Google Play offers easier updates and better trust signals. Always download from reputable sources and confirm permissions before installing.

Are there subscription differences I should be aware of?

Yes. Some services sell channel bundles, some sell per-device access, and others use account-based logins. Verify concurrent stream limits, device compatibility, and whether catch-up or recordings are included before subscribing.

Can I use the same player across phone, tablet, TV, and Chromebook?

Many players offer versions for phones, tablets, and Android TV; some also work on Chromebooks that support Android apps. Check the developer’s compatibility notes and test features like remote navigation and scaling on each device.

How do I improve streaming speed and reduce buffering?

Use a wired Ethernet connection on boxes when possible, enable hardware decoding in the player, choose lower bitrate streams during peak times, and ensure your router and ISP plan match the bandwidth needs for multiple streams.

What support should I expect from a good player developer?

Look for clear documentation, setup guides, active forums or Telegram/Discord communities, and prompt updates. Developers who publish changelogs and respond to bug reports usually provide a better long-term experience.

Leave a Comment

Your email address will not be published. Required fields are marked *